Subaru Crosstrek manuals

Subaru Crosstrek Service Manual: Dtc p0351 ignition coil "a" primary control circuit/open

ENGINE (DIAGNOSTICS)(H4DO) > Diagnostic Procedure with Diagnostic Trouble Code (DTC)

DTC P0351 IGNITION COIL "A" PRIMARY CONTROL CIRCUIT/OPEN

DTC detecting condition:

Immediately at fault recognition

Trouble symptom:

Improper idling

Poor driving performance

CAUTION:

After servicing or replacing faulty parts, perform Clear Memory Mode Clear Memory Mode > OPERATION">, and Inspection Mode Inspection Mode > PROCEDURE">.

Wiring diagram:

Engine electrical system Engine Electrical System">

STEPCHECKYESNO

1.CHECK IGNITION COIL POWER SUPPLY CIRCUIT.

1) Turn the ignition switch to OFF.

2) Disconnect the connector from ignition coil.

3) Turn the ignition switch to ON.

4) Measure the voltage between ignition coil connector and engine ground.

Connector & terminal

DTC P0351; (E31) No. 1 (+) — Engine ground (−):

DTC P0352; (E32) No. 1 (+) — Engine ground (−):

DTC P0353; (E33) No. 1 (+) — Engine ground (−):

DTC P0354; (E34) No. 1 (+) — Engine ground (−):

Is the voltage 10 V or more?

Diagnostic Procedure with Diagnostic Trouble Code (DTC) > DTC P0351 IGNITION COIL "A" PRIMARY CONTROL CIRCUIT/OPEN">Go to Step 2.

Repair the harness and connector.

NOTE:

In this case, repair the following item:

Open or short to ground in harness of power supply circuit

Blown out of fuse

Poor contact of IG relay connector

Poor contact of coupling connector

Faulty IG relay

2.CHECK HARNESS OF IGNITION COIL GROUND CIRCUIT.

1) Turn the ignition switch to OFF.

2) Measure the resistance of harness between ignition coil connector and engine ground.

Connector & terminal

DTC P0351; (E31) No. 3 — Engine ground:

DTC P0352; (E32) No. 3 — Engine ground:

DTC P0353; (E33) No. 3 — Engine ground:

DTC P0354; (E34) No. 3 — Engine ground:

Is the resistance less than 5 ??

Diagnostic Procedure with Diagnostic Trouble Code (DTC) > DTC P0351 IGNITION COIL "A" PRIMARY CONTROL CIRCUIT/OPEN">Go to Step 3.

Repair the open circuit in harness between ignition coil connector and engine grounding terminal.

3.CHECK HARNESS BETWEEN ECM AND IGNITION COIL CONNECTOR.

1) Disconnect the connector from ECM.

2) Measure the resistance between ignition coil connector and engine ground.

Connector & terminal

DTC P0351; (E31) No. 2 — Engine ground:

DTC P0352; (E32) No. 2 — Engine ground:

DTC P0353; (E33) No. 2 — Engine ground:

DTC P0354; (E34) No. 2 — Engine ground:

Is the resistance 1 M? or more?

Diagnostic Procedure with Diagnostic Trouble Code (DTC) > DTC P0351 IGNITION COIL "A" PRIMARY CONTROL CIRCUIT/OPEN">Go to Step 4.

Repair the ground short circuit of harness between ECM connector and ignition coil connector.

4.CHECK HARNESS BETWEEN ECM AND IGNITION COIL CONNECTOR.

Measure the resistance of harness between ECM connector and ignition coil connector.

Connector & terminal

DTC P0351; (B134) No. 21 — (E31) No. 2:

DTC P0352; (B134) No. 10 — (E32) No. 2:

DTC P0353; (B134) No. 31 — (E33) No. 2:

DTC P0354; (B134) No. 8 — (E34) No. 2:

Is the resistance less than 1 ??

Diagnostic Procedure with Diagnostic Trouble Code (DTC) > DTC P0351 IGNITION COIL "A" PRIMARY CONTROL CIRCUIT/OPEN">Go to Step 5.

Repair the harness and connector.

NOTE:

In this case, repair the following item:

Open circuit of harness between ECM connector and the ignition coil connector

Poor contact of coupling connector

5.CHECK FOR POOR CONTACT.

Check for poor contact of ECM connector.

Is there poor contact of ECM connector?

Repair the poor contact of ECM connector.

Diagnostic Procedure with Diagnostic Trouble Code (DTC) > DTC P0351 IGNITION COIL "A" PRIMARY CONTROL CIRCUIT/OPEN">Go to Step 6.

6.CHECK SPARK PLUG CONDITION.

1) Remove the spark plug of the corresponding cylinder. Spark Plug > REMOVAL">

2) Check the spark plug condition. Spark Plug > INSPECTION">

Is the check result OK?

Replace the ignition coil. Ignition Coil">

Replace the spark plug. Spark Plug">

1. OUTLINE OF DIAGNOSIS

Based on the self-diagnostic result of the ignition coil driving IC, judge the ignition coil driving circuit as normal or abnormal.

The ignition coil driving IC detects “no ignition” status as a malfunction.

2. EXECUTION CONDITION

Secondary parameters

Execution condition

Battery voltage

≥ 10.9 V

Elapsed time after starting the engine

> 1 s

Engine speed

≥ 500 rpm

3. GENERAL DRIVING CYCLE

Always perform the diagnosis continuously.

4. DIAGNOSTIC METHOD

Judge as NG when the following conditions are established.

Judgment Value

Malfunction Criteria

Threshold Value

Ignition driving IC information

Trouble

Time Needed for Diagnosis: 2560 ms

Malfunction Indicator Light Illumination: Illuminates as soon as a malfunction occurs.

Dtc p0346 camshaft position sensor "a" circuit range/performance bank 2
ENGINE (DIAGNOSTICS)(H4DO) > Diagnostic Procedure with Diagnostic Trouble Code (DTC)DTC P0346 CAMSHAFT POSITION SENSOR "A" CIRCUIT RANGE/PERFORMANCE BANK 2NOTE:For the diagnostic procedur ...

Dtc p0352 ignition coil "b" primary control circuit/open
ENGINE (DIAGNOSTICS)(H4DO) > Diagnostic Procedure with Diagnostic Trouble Code (DTC)DTC P0352 IGNITION COIL "B" PRIMARY CONTROL CIRCUIT/OPENNOTE:For the diagnostic procedure, refer to DTC ...

Other materials:

Caution
AIRBAG SYSTEM > General DescriptionCAUTION1. BEFORE STARTING ALL WORKS• Before performing vehicle maintenance, turn the ignition switch to OFF and disconnect the negative terminal from battery. NOTE">• The airbag system (including pretensioner) is fitted with a backup power s ...

Removal
EXTERIOR/INTERIOR TRIM > Center ConsoleREMOVAL1. Remove the center grille assembly. Air Vent Grille > REMOVAL">2. Remove the audio assembly or navigation assembly. Audio > REMOVAL"> ...

Control screen and panel
Control screen (main screen and station screen) Select to display the audio source selection screen. Select to open the station list. Refer to "Using aha application" Select to fast forward the current content item by 30 seconds. Select to display the contents list of the selec ...

© 2016-2024 Copyright www.sucross.com